So my EAR 509's returned from a service at EAR, all present and correct. A new set of valves were fitted, Tim's Russian sourced ECC83 ECC85 and PL519's. Seeing as I have replacement sets of better valves than Tim's (heresy I know but they are) I thought I'd fit them. This turned put to be a little more complicated than one might initially expect.

To fit the new valves I of course have to remove the valve covers, they are fitted with hidden crosshead phillips No2 screws, and the valve covers are 130mm high. I don't have a 130mm+ No2 screwdriver, neither do Screwfix, or B&Q nor any of the other places I tried. In fact the trouble is that the hole in the valve cover which the screwdriver must pass through isn't actually wide enough to pass the long handled screwdrivers through, and the thinner shafted ones aren't long enough. A quick search on the web finds nowhere stocks them.

When I sent them off for service they were fitted with slotted screws, but the powers that be at EAR swapped them out for crossheads- arses. So I end up taking the Dremmel to the handle of the 125mm thin shaft Phillips No1 driver that I have, I cut away 15mm of plastic handle and it now reaches the captive screw. Of course this doesn't help because the No1 is to shallow to fit the head and spins freely without biting. I then have to take the tip of the driver bit off with the Dremmel to make it fit.

Finally the cover comes off and the better 519's go in first. Naturally i have to bias them, so off comes the bottom. Not wanting to scratch the hell out of everything I screw the feet back in, naturally. I plug it in power it up, and WFT, that last valve is going some shade of red, holy shit, that is reading 11volts instead of 400mv, click, turn it off fast before we achieve meltdown.

Jesus, that was close. I swap the old valve back in to be safe and fire it up again- crap its off again run away thermal meltdown. I hit the switch in time again having caught the bias on the up a lot earlier this time. I'm flummoxed. I have altered nothing, swapped nothing, broken nothing, desoldered nothing, so WTF is up with this thermal run away. I trudge upstairs to the laptop and hit PRINT, out pops the schematic I've been working on, re-labeling all the parts from Tim's original 1979 hand drawn version that is all but illegible.

I then spend several hours after removing the two main pcbs and going over every single component in the amp, they are in within spec, of course they are I've just paid £500 for a bloody service and new valves. I can see no flaws. Now I'm no Tim, or an Anthony, or a Lurcher, hell I'm barely valve amp literate, but i can follow a schematic with 100% accuracy and I do know all the parts in this amp (probably better than Tim does seeing as i've spent 10-20 hours redoing the schematic this past week).

I'm stuck, honestly, utterly lost, what was causing this runaway?

So I reassemble everything, leaving the bottom off of course so I can still measure bias, and just as I'm sliding one of the pcb's back in up to the edge of the casework I'm looking at the feet, the feet that normally bolt through the bottom plate of the amp, which of course isn't in place. The feet that are now 2mm longer than they were before I took the plate off. You've guessed it...

One of them is now sticking 2mm through the back of the casework, where normally it wouldn't stand proud at all and the back of that screw is now making contact with the pcb- and effectively sinking the anode cap of the last 519 valve straight through the casework to ground...

If your cabling is neatly loomed then you're more likely to have induced crosstalk.
Sometimes it's better to not be so tidy with the wiring.
Obviously, you don't want things to be like a rat's nest, 'cos that makes working on the thing nigh on impossible.....:eyebrows:

Chris is right in a certain respect ;) Even in a solid state amp certain wires can be grouped together to preclude the possibility of induced noise, where as other cabling feeding the same semiconductor may well need to have a wide berth.

In the case of stuff that needs to be kept apart it's always best to keep the cables at right angles to each other as well, thus there will be the minimum area of interaction.

I did notice that the input sensitivity of the 509's is rated at 1.6v, I had my Weiss set for a maximum output of 1.2v, so I've now set that to 2.2v and wound the pots on the 509's back to about half- halving the noise at my speakers but keeping output volume the same. I never run the Weiss wide open at 0db, my max -18db measures up at near enough bang on 1.6v pp.
